MySQL配置表内存溢出是指MySQL在处理数据时,由于内存分配不足,导致无法正常处理数据,进而引发系统崩溃或性能下降的现象。这通常发生在处理大量数据或复杂查询时。
innodb_buffer_pool_size
、sort_buffer_size
等)设置不合理。innodb_buffer_pool_size
,这是InnoDB存储引擎用于缓存数据和索引的内存区域大小。sort_buffer_size
,这是用于排序操作的内存大小。sort_buffer_size
,这是用于排序操作的内存大小。SELECT *
,只选择需要的列。SELECT *
,只选择需要的列。max_connections
参数限制同时打开的数据库连接数。max_connections
参数限制同时打开的数据库连接数。SHOW GLOBAL STATUS
、EXPLAIN
等)来监控和调优数据库性能。SHOW GLOBAL STATUS
、EXPLAIN
等)来监控和调优数据库性能。通过以上方法,可以有效解决MySQL配置表内存溢出的问题,提升数据库的性能和稳定性。
领取专属 10元无门槛券
手把手带您无忧上云